Problem
Possible cause
Solution
The iron is plugged 
in, but the soleplate 
stays cold.
There is a connection 
problem.
Check the mains cord, the plug and the wall 
socket.
The temperature dial is set 
to MIN.
Set the temperature dial to the required position
The iron does not 
produce any steam.
There is not enough water 
in the water tank.
Fill the water tank (see chapter ‘Preparing for use’, 
section ‘Filling the water tank).
The steam control is set to 
position 0.
Set the steam control to a position between 1 
and 4 (see chapter ‘Using the appliance’, section 
‘Steam ironing’).
The iron is not hot enough 
and/or the drip-stop 
function has been activated 
(specific types only).
Set an ironing temperature that is suitable for 
steam ironing ( 2 to MAX). Put the iron on its 
heel and wait until the temperature light goes out 
before you start ironing.
Water droplets 
drip onto the fabric 
during ironing.
You have put an additive in 
the water tank.
Rinse the water tank and do not put any additive 
in the water tank.
You have not closed the cap 
of the filling opening 
properly.
Press the cap until you hear a click.
Flakes and impurities 
come out of the 
soleplate during 
ironing.
Hard water forms flakes 
inside the soleplate.
Use the Calc-Clean function one or more times 
(see chapter ‘Cleaning and maintenance’, section 
‘Calc-Clean function’).
The red auto-off 
light flashes.
The automatic shut-off 
function has switched off the 
iron (see chapter ‘Features’).
Move the iron slightly to deactivate the automatic 
shut-off function. The red auto-off light goes out.
Water drips from 
the soleplate after 
the iron has cooled 
down or has been 
stored (specific 
types only).
You have put the iron in 
horizontal position while 
there was still water in the 
water tank.
Always set the steam control to position 0 and 
empty the water tank after use. Store the iron on 
its heel.
The iron does not 
produce a steam 
boost.
You used the steam boost 
function too often within a 
short period.
Continue ironing in horizontal position and wait 
a while before you use the steam boost function 
again.
The iron is not hot enough.
Set an ironing temperature at which the steam 
boost function can be used (temperature settings 
2
 to MAX). Put the iron on its heel and wait 
until the temperature light goes out before you 
use the steam boost function.
